2nd Durham man arrested in fatal shooting of 22-year-old in Raleigh
Almost a year after a 22-year-old man was fatally shot in Raleigh, police have arrested a second man in his death, officials announced Monday.
Emmanuel Ajene Jones, 22, of Durham, is charged with murder and felony obstructing justice in the Dec. 2, 2023, death of Nicolas Ricardo Carrasco-Domenech, police said.
Carrasco-Domenech was found with multiple gunshot wounds in the 100 block of Summit Avenue in the Caraleigh neighborhood. at 8:37 p.m. An autopsy report released to The News & Observer on Tuesday shows he was shot at least six times and beaten about the head, neck, torso and extremities.
Marcus Anthony Fletcher, 23, also of Durham, was arrested two days after Carrasco-Domenech’s death on a charge of murder.
Details are scant, but court records show Jones was indicted on Nov. 18. The indictment alleges he deliberately misled homicide detectives from Jan. 27, 2024, to March 24, 2024, about the details of Carrasco-Domenech’s death.
“The defendant plotted with other parties to remove and destroy evidence related to the murder of Nicolas Carrasco-Domenech,” the indictment states.
Fletcher and Jones remained in the Wake County jail without bail as of Monday afternoon. Jones is scheduled to be arraigned Dec. 9 at the Wake County courthouse, records show.
